Cornelia Blasig is a scholar working on Oncology, Epidemiology and Infectious Diseases. According to data from OpenAlex, Cornelia Blasig has authored 5 papers receiving a total of 489 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 4 papers in Oncology, 4 papers in Epidemiology and 3 papers in Infectious Diseases. Recurrent topics in Cornelia Blasig's work include Viral-associated cancers and disorders (4 papers), Cytomegalovirus and herpesvirus research (4 papers) and Parvovirus B19 Infection Studies (2 papers). Cornelia Blasig is often cited by papers focused on Viral-associated cancers and disorders (4 papers), Cytomegalovirus and herpesvirus research (4 papers) and Parvovirus B19 Infection Studies (2 papers). Cornelia Blasig collaborates with scholars based in Germany, Sweden and Austria. Cornelia Blasig's co-authors include Michael Stürzl, Norbert H. Brockmeyer, Frank Neipel, Erwin Tschachler, Sandra Colombini, Barbara Ensoli, C Zietz, Susan R. Opalenik, Myrtle A. Davis and H.-G. Guo and has published in prestigious journals such as JNCI Journal of the National Cancer Institute, Journal of Virology and International Journal of Cancer.
